def solution(s):
answer = []
ch = {}
for i in range(len(s)):
if s[i] in ch:
answer.append(i - ch[s[i]])
ch[s[i]] = i
else:
ch[s[i]] = i
answer.append(-1)
return answer
728x90
반응형
LIST
'알고리즘' 카테고리의 다른 글
[프로그래머스] 문자열 내 마음대로 정렬하기 (0) | 2023.10.09 |
---|---|
[프로그래머스] K번째 수 (0) | 2023.10.09 |
[프로그래머스] 푸드 파이트 대회 (0) | 2023.10.09 |
[프로그래머스] 두 개 뽑아서 더하기 (0) | 2023.10.09 |
[프로그래머스] 콜라 문제 (0) | 2023.10.07 |